MEMO — Headcount Plan, Next Fiscal Year

To the finance team: the draft plan adds 14 roles — eight in engineering at the Ashvale office, four in support, two in compliance. Backfills are budgeted separately. Salary assumptions use the revised banding from Corvel Analytics. Please load these figures into the planning model by Friday. The rationale is summarized in the note below.

board note of kageg-bahof: The renewal with Holwynax Holdings closes at $2 million a year, 5 percent below the last contract. Project Ulaath slips by two quarters because of the supplier delay.

Handover: alert dedup (Quellbird). Shipped the new fingerprint hashing Tuesday; dupes down ~70%. Known issue: alerts from the Marlow cluster still split when labels reorder — fix queued, not merged. Don't touch the suppression window config; Priya's A/B test runs through Friday. Pager volume should stay flat. If dedup rates dip below 60%, roll back to build 41. Full context and rollback steps are on the internal page.

runbook for badug-kadup: https://confluence.zemvarlabs.internal/projects/browse/display/projects/bd1b

Subject: Quickstore 4.2 — bloom filter now fronts the KV layer

Plugin authors: starting with this release, Quickstore places a bloom filter ahead of the key-value store. Negative lookups return faster; false positives fall through safely. No API changes are required on your side. Verify your plugin against the staging build referenced below.

session token of fahif-tadup = htk3_9c7

**Leadership Review Briefing: Gross-Margin Review**

Margins at Tarnwick Industries declined 1.8 points year over year, driven by input costs on the Solent range and expedited shipping. Mitigations underway: renegotiated supplier terms, SKU rationalization, and a freight consolidation pilot in the Averley region. Recovery to target expected within two quarters. Strategic planning context follows below.

internal memo for kawip-hadug: Headcount on the Wenwyn team goes from 7 to 140 by the end of January. Gross margin on Wenwyn came in at 20 percent against a plan of 15 percent.